Abstract

A bias circuit for a bipolar transistor includes a constant voltage source connected to a base electrode of the bipolar transistor; and a resistor connected in series between the constant voltage source and the base electrode of the bipolar transistor. By selecting an appropriate resistance for this resistor, the bias point moves due to a change in the voltage drop across the resistor. The change occurs because the base current flowing through the resistor changes, whereby the operating class of the transistor changes, resulting in a high efficiency at a desired output power.
